In this conversation, Dr. Sharon Black and Dr. Nichola Ashby explore the concept of respect, emphasizing that it should not be based on hierarchy but rather on mutual recognition of humanity. Dr. Black argues that respect is a fundamental human quality that should be extended to everyone, regardless of their position or role.
Takeaways:
-Respect isn't about hierarchy.
-It's about being a decent human being.
-Mutual respect is essential in professional relationships.
-Respect should be based on humanity, not roles.
-Hierarchy should not dictate respect.
-Everyone deserves respect regardless of their position.
-Understanding others' perspectives is crucial.
-Respect fosters better communication.
-Building relationships requires mutual recognition.
-Respect is a fundamental human quality.
